Concurrent enforcement of polyconvexity and true-stress-true-strain monotonicity in incompressible isotropic hyperelasticity: application to neural network constitutive models
Polyconvexity implies true-stress-true-strain monotonicity in incompressible isotropic hyperelasticity, which is enforced in four PANN architectures that show varying extrapolation behavior on experimental data.
